Depending on where you're coming from, your journey to Tui could be simple and straightforward or it could drag on forever. Below are some useful travel tips that will help you start your next unforgettable escape on a positive note.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- First, put in your passport, official ID, cash and vital medications. Next, you'll need some extra in-flight entertainment to while away the hours. A juicy novel and a tablet filled with your favorite movies are some terrific options. If you intend to catch forty winks, a comfy neck pillow and a pair of noise-canceling headphones will also be useful. Finally, squeeze in a few toiletry items to ensure you step off the plane looking fresh and ready to go.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- While the list of restricted items differs between airlines, the general guide to follow is nothing s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es things like screwdrivers, drills, aerosol cans and flares. Sporting equipment like baseball bats, and objects that could injure passengers, such as firearms and swords, aren't allowed in the cabin either.
What to wear on a flight:
- Your aim is to feel as comfortable as you can. Choose a pair of slip-on shoes, dress in loose, breathable clothing and don't forget to take a sweater in case you get chilly in the cabin.
- The result of sustained periods of inactivity,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clotting condition that can affect some passengers during long-distance flights. Reduce the risks by staying hydrated, keeping your ankles and legs moving and wearing compression socks to help your circulation.
